Abstract
The utility model discloses a solar disinsection device, which comprises an insect-luring lamp, a disinsection device and an insect storage chamber, wherein the insect-luring lamp, the disinsection device and the insect storage chamber compose a traditional disinsection device. The disinsection device is powered by a solar energy device, which comprises a solar battery, a chargeable and dischargeable control device and a chargeable battery, wherein the solar battery transforms the solar energy to charge the chargeable battery through the chargeable and dischargeable control device, the chargeable battery powers the insect-luring lamp and the disinsection device, the chargeable and dischargeable control device is equipped with a photosensitive component and a time control switch, the insect-luring lamp is capable of automatic adjustment of the brightness of the lamp according to the brightness of the sky to lure and to destroy insects in the disinsection device, and the bodies of the insects will fall into the insect storage chamber. Comparing with the prior disinsection devices, this utility model utilizes natural light, adopts intelligent control to realize automatic blacking out during the day and automatic lightening at night without manual operation, thereby being environmental protective.
Description
Technical field
The utility model relates to a kind of insect killer, particularly relates to a kind of solar powered insect killer that adopts.
Background technology
The become principle of light, " a flying moth darts into the fire " of existing insect killer general using mosquito is catched and killed mosquito, the energy of its flare up often adopts fuel oil, candle, accumulator or AC power etc., there are a lot of inconvenience in the use in the supply of this class energy, as lighting time weak point, inconvenient operation, easily contaminated environment, be subjected to extraneous power limitations, be difficult to realize control automatically etc., can not satisfy the needs of a lot of occasions.
The utility model content
The purpose of this utility model be to provide a kind of energy-saving and environmental protecting, lighting time long, the solar energy insect killer that tube just, is not subjected to extraneous restriction, can realizes Based Intelligent Control is installed.
A kind of solar energy insect killer that the utility model provides, comprise light trap, bug killing equipment and insect storage space, light trap, bug killing equipment and insect storage space constitute a traditional insect killer, described insect killer provides power supply by solar energy equipment, wherein solar energy equipment comprises solar cell, charging/discharging control device and chargeable cell, described solar cell converts solar energy to electric energy and charges to chargeable cell by charging/discharging control device, for insect killer provides power supply.
Charging/discharging control device described in the utility model is provided with light-sensitive element and time control switch, and light trap can be realized turning off the light daytime, and evening, bright lamp was promptly regulated light automatically with sky brightness.
Light trap described in the utility model can adopt black light pipe, also can adopt LED or other power saving fluorescent lamps, connect by electric wire, and be its power supply by chargeable cell; At rainy weather, chargeable cell also has from the function of AC power supplies charging.
Various physics or pest control with insecticide devices such as bug killing equipment described in the utility model comprises that electricity kills, wind kills, water kills, stickingly kill, poisoning, medicine are killed, the mosquito that kills falls into insect storage space, and insect storage space detachably clears up.
The utility model is compared with existing insect killer, has the following advantages:
(1) adopted solar electric power supply system, energy-saving and environmental protecting are pollution-free, and the desinsection cost is low.
(2) adopted Based Intelligent Control, light trap and bug killing equipment all can be realized working automatically evening, and need not manual operation.
(3) solar energy insect killer is not limited by external condition, and is easy for installation, windproof and rain proof, long service life.

Embodiment
As shown in Figure 1, the solar energy insect killer of the utility model embodiment one, be made up of insect killer and solar energy equipment, wherein insect killer comprises light trap 4, bug killing equipment 5 and insect storage space 6, and solar energy equipment comprises solar cell 1, charging/discharging control device 2 chargeable celies 3; Solar cell 1 is installed in the top of a support, can be with the direction at sunshine adjusting angle, charging/discharging control device 2 and chargeable cell 3 are installed in the middle part of support, solar cell 1 is connected with chargeable cell 3 with charging/discharging control device 2 by the electric wire in the support tube, light trap 4, bug killing equipment 5 and insect storage space 6 are suspended on the suspension rod of support, and chargeable cell 3 provides power supply by the electric wire in the suspension rod pipe for it.
As shown in Figure 2, the solar energy insect killer of the utility model embodiment two, be made up of insect killer and solar energy equipment, wherein insect killer comprises light trap 4, bug killing equipment 5 and insect storage space 6, and solar energy equipment comprises solar cell 1, charging/discharging control device 2 chargeable celies 3; Solar cell 1 is installed in the top of translucent tube in the basin, light trap 4 is installed in the translucent tube, charging/discharging control device 2 and chargeable cell 3 are installed in the bottom of basin, and profit in basin and the basin constitutes bug killing equipment 5 and insect storage space 6, when mosquito becomes the light time and falls into the water.
